    Could these be French? I can't make out anything inside the indentations which doesn't help! The bracelet tests as 800 silver.

    Ditto, but neither the shape of the marks nor the style of the bracelet strike me as French.
    If the marks are maker's marks instead of assay marks, they could be very difficult to find.
    That style filigree and 800 silver could be Germany or Italy, but also a few others.
